How Long Should You Wash Your Hands to Effectively Remove Germs?
Learn how washing your hands for at least 20 seconds with soap helps prevent infections and ensures proper hygiene.
Video transcript
Wash your hands for at least 20 seconds to effectively remove germs. This is equivalent to singing the 'Happy Birthday' song twice. Use soap and water, scrubbing all parts of your hands, including the backs, between your fingers, and under your nails. Proper handwashing reduces the spread of infections and ensures good hygiene.
